Output 155f59a39a85954d0bf43b925c576fe58584d023faabdc4601cbbf2efad0a1b5:0

value
8667885
script pubkey
OP_0 OP_PUSHBYTES_20 ef4744edf3f148090dc78edd256a1e4a91c7e5c2
address
ltc1qaar5fm0n79yqjrw83mwj26s7f2gu0ewz4h4zsq
transaction
155f59a39a85954d0bf43b925c576fe58584d023faabdc4601cbbf2efad0a1b5
spent
true